IHS ESDU General guide to the choice of journal bearing type. 65007

Description
ESDU 65007 provides a guide in the early stages of design to the choice of the type of journal bearing that is most likely to give the required performance. It is emphasised that general guidance only is provided and, in particular cases, other considerations may affect the final choice. When the type of bearing has been chosen (from the types considered, namely, dry rubbing, hydrodynamic, hydrostatic, oil impregnated porous metal, and rolling element) other data, or manufacturer's information where appropriate, must be used for the final design.
